Cha-Yen — Thai Iced Tea Recipe: A Refreshing Touch of Asia

Thai iced tea is a classic, non-alcoholic Pan-Asian drink. In Thailand it is served in restaurants and also sold as a takeaway, often poured into a plastic bag instead of a glass.
